I am trying to get the ircbot provided by the hobbit-plugins package
(version 20100527). My xymon version is 4.3.0~beta2.dfsg-6+squeeze1

I get the IRC script to run and it provides this output, and then hangs
after the connecting line indefinitely (unless I cause it to get some sort
of message it will log)


2011-08-22 20:28:23 Tried to down BOARDBUSY: Invalid argument
2011-08-22 20:28:35 Peer not up, flushing message queue
Mon Aug 22 20:28:35 2011 Connecting to 10.194.138.102


To confirm it is not connectivity, I telneted as the hobbit user and even
used IRSSI and was able to connect to the server with no problems.  Anyone
use this functionality and have it working?

Am I simply version mis-matching or is this a known issue?

I found the cause of this.  You are required to have an MOTD on your server
or it never hits the on_connect subroutine
